The owner, Laura really invested in communications before I arrived. She discussed my requirements and switched me to the best room for me (I'm very tall). She was available to support the whole way through my stay-really helpful. Also worth mentioning, the rooms are really special, they're all very beautifully furnished with antiques etc, and are warm and comfy with all the bits and pieces you'd expect from a quality boutique hotel:-) Worth noting the hotel is above a wine bar/restaurant. When I checked in I was little worried to find ear-plugs on the bed-side table. In the end, this wasn't a problem at all, but if you go to bed early (before 10pm) then this may not be the hotel for you.

I had a lovely experience in Room 6, the attic room. It's quirky yet tastefully decorated, with a warm atmosphere perfect for a February stay. The bed was incredibly soft but still offered great support, and the heavy weighted duvet and an abundance of cushions made it extra cozy. The location is ideal – right in the historic part of Macclesfield, with plenty of shops, cafes, pubs and restaurants just a stone's throw away. The cafe bar on the ground floor looks lovely (although I didn’t get a chance to try the food or drinks this time, I’ll definitely do so next visit). Overall, a great stay! I’ll certainly return and explore more of the cafe offerings next time.
There is no reception. Self check-in felt a bit like Airbnb, but the staff I spoke with in the cafe was super friendly and helpful when I arrived. One thing to note: the en suite bathroom is tiny, tucked into the eaves of the building. As someone who's 162cm tall with a slim build, it was fine for me, but if you're on the taller side, Room 6 might feel cramped.

The hotel was in a good location. Staff very welcoming and helpful. Down stairs was a small bar and restaurant which had a good atmosphere. I was concerned the room could be noisy but the staff were considerate and things toned down late evening. Parking in the nearby carpark was safe and cheap. The room and bed were a nice size. The room had an art deco feel to it and nicely done. The room had tea/coffee facilities and tv. There were nice little touches like a hand written welcome card, some small treats and a small cake in a tin. The room was nice and warm and for me the bed was very comfortable. The ensuite bathroom looked quite new and was very clean. It had a good shower and the water stayed warm. There was a hair dryer and towels too. There were codes for the entrance door and the room which were great. No keys to worry about and I could come and go as I pleased. The location was near to shops, pubs and restaurants. I stayed two nights over Christmas and enjoyed my stay. I would stay there again.
I booked through booking.com and picked the more expensive room as this included breakfast. I stayed Christmas eve and Christmas day. The hotel emailed me to say the kitchen would be closed on Christmas day morning a continental breakfast would be left outside my door. This was fine. I emailed back to confirm and asked if Boxing day morning would be the same. I said I would be happy with that. They replied saying Boxing breakfast would be back to normal. I received the first breakfast ok. Unfortunately on the boxing day I waited till 9am but there was no sign of the staff or the kitchen being open. It was annoying as I had paid for a breakfast and had to go without as I had to leave and had a 4hr onward journey.
